CHEM 380
Medicinal Chemistry
Nevada State University · UGRD · Fall 2026
1 section
Catalog description
This course focuses on how the interplay between chemistry and pharmacology has contributed to the development of drugs. The fundamentals of medicinal chemistry are emphasized by the study of receptor-protein structure in relation to drug targets, various drug classes, their mechanism of action, metabolism, and toxicology. Pre-requisite(s): CHEM 241 (with a C- or better).
